Reavis Dominates Bremen

Burbank, IL (April 4, 2011) - The Varsity Girls Soccer Team (6-1, 3-0) kept their momentum going with a dominant performance beating Bremen 5-0 for their fifth win in a row! 

While only 1-0 at the half, Reavis controlled the ball in spite of having the wind against them.  Though the Rams had multiple opportunities to score in the first half, they struggled to find the back of the net.  This changed immediately after the start of the second half.  The Rams broke the game open within the first few minutes of the half with goals by Ana Valdez and Chanel Koepke.  Reavis possessed the ball almost the entire half allowing only 3 attempts on goal for the Braves. The entire team worked well moving the ball and aggressively challenging any attempts at possession by Bremen. 

Scoring for the Rams was Ana Valdez with 3 goals and 1 assist (9 goals, 3 assists on the season), Chanel Koepke with 2 goals (8 goals, 4 assists on the season), and Gosia Skora with an assist (1 goal, 1 assist on the season).  An excellent game of soccer, ladies!
